Shuk Carmel—outdoor market! The shut is an experience that you have to go into with all senses. Go around and smell the aromas, look at the vibrant colors, touch and taste the different fruit, and listen to the craziness going on! You can find some amazing stuff there too and a cheap and delicious lunch!
